西门子PLC教程:从基础知识到I/O地址分配
需积分: 0 29 浏览量
更新于2024-08-23
收藏 11.6MB PPT 举报
"西门子s7-300图文教程关于I/O地址分配的讲解"
本教程聚焦于西门子PLC系统,特别是S7-300系列,通过详细的章节分布,深入介绍了PLC的基本概念和技术。教程首先从PLC的概述开始,讲解了PLC的产生背景,定义及其分类。PLC作为一种先进的自动控制装置,起源于对传统继电器控制系统的改进,以解决其体积大、接线复杂和可靠性差的问题。1969年,美国数字设备公司(DEC)推出了第一台PLC,主要用于顺序控制。
在PLC的定义部分,了解到PLC是专为工业环境设计的计算机,具有丰富的I/O接口和强大的驱动能力。国际电工委员会(IEC)的定义强调了PLC的存储程序功能,执行各种操作指令,控制工业生产过程。根据结构和规模,PLC分为一体化紧凑型和标准模块式,例如西门子的S7-200系列属于前者,而S7-300和S7-400系列则属于后者。
教程接着介绍了如何使用STEP7软件创建PLC工程,这是西门子PLC编程的基础工具。学习PLC编程语言,理解并掌握Ladder Logic(梯形图)、Structured Text(结构文本)等语言对于编写和调试PLC程序至关重要。此外,第五章西门子的程序设计将指导读者如何有效地组织和实施控制逻辑。
在第六章,教程转向了WinCC flexible软件,这是一款用于创建HMI(人机界面)工程的工具,能够帮助用户实现与PLC之间的交互界面设计,提供实时监控和数据采集功能。
关于I/O地址分配表,这是PLC编程中的关键环节。每个输入和输出设备在PLC内部都有一个特定的地址,通过这个地址,PLC可以识别和处理与外部设备的通信。例如,S7-300系列的I/O模块,如DI(数字输入)和DO(数字输出)模块,它们在系统中的位置和地址配置直接影响到程序的编写和系统运行。
本教程涵盖了从基础理论到实际操作的全面内容,对于想要了解和掌握西门子PLC系统的初学者来说是一份宝贵的参考资料。通过学习,读者将能够理解PLC的工作原理,掌握编程方法,以及如何进行I/O地址分配,从而有效地运用到实际的自动化项目中。
2019-11-07 上传
2021-08-18 上传
423 浏览量
2023-06-08 上传
2024-10-26 上传
2024-10-26 上传
2024-10-26 上传
2024-10-26 上传
2024-10-28 上传
Pa1nk1LLeR
- 粉丝: 67
- 资源: 2万+
最新资源
- WordPress作为新闻管理面板的实现指南
- NPC_Generator:使用Ruby打造的游戏角色生成器
- MATLAB实现变邻域搜索算法源码解析
- 探索C++并行编程:使用INTEL TBB的项目实践
- 玫枫跟打器:网页版五笔打字工具,提升macOS打字效率
- 萨尔塔·阿萨尔·希塔斯:SATINDER项目解析
- 掌握变邻域搜索算法:MATLAB代码实践
- saaraansh: 简化法律文档,打破语言障碍的智能应用
- 探索牛角交友盲盒系统:PHP开源交友平台的新选择
- 探索Nullfactory-SSRSExtensions: 强化SQL Server报告服务
- Lotide:一套JavaScript实用工具库的深度解析
- 利用Aurelia 2脚手架搭建新项目的快速指南
- 变邻域搜索算法Matlab实现教程
- 实战指南:构建高效ES+Redis+MySQL架构解决方案
- GitHub Pages入门模板快速启动指南
- NeonClock遗产版:包名更迭与应用更新